Pakistan, July 27 -- The United States and Pakistan strengthened their partnership in higher education on Friday with the formal launch of the National Institute of Technology (NIT), established in collaboration with Arizona State University.
Speaking at the launch ceremony, US Consul General in Lahore, Christin K. Hawkins, said, "The establishment of NIT symbolises the enduring commitment of the United States to Pakistan's educational development. We believe in empowering the youth through access to high-quality learning. This partnership is not just about infrastructure-it's about ideas, innovation, and future leadership."
